Shakespeare’s eternal tragic story of young love between warring Italian families is performed free, outdoors, in six Chicago parks. Audiences are encouraged to come early and bring a picnic to enjoy this free programming. Seating is first come, first served, and audience members can bring their own blankets or chairs.
Free Reservations are encouraged but not required. Those with reservations will be contacted in the event of weather cancellations or other last minute updates.
